Antonio Brown's time in Pittsburgh appears all but over ... 'cause Steelers owner Art Rooney II doesn't expect the NFL superstar to be on the team next season.
A.B.'s been at the center of controversy in Steel City after getting into heated exchanges with teammates, skipping practice, getting benched for a crucial game during a playoff push AND reportedly requesting a trade ... just to name a few incidents.
Rooney says the team will NOT cut Brown, but made it very clear the Steelers aren't afraid to move on from their top receiver ... and said it would be "hard to envision" he's with the team come training camp in July.
"There’s not much we can do right now. We have time to make a decision,” Rooney told the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ette.
“We’ll look at all the options. We’re not going to release him, that’s not on the table. But I will say all other options are on the table."
Rooney isn't completely shutting the door on reconciling with Brown ... he thinks making up is possible, but unlikely.
“Whether the situation can be reconciled and have him back on the team next year, we’re a long way away from thinking that can happen. We’re not closing the door on anything at this point.”

Le'Veon Bell Doesn't Report, Out For Season ... Forfeits $14.5 Million
Le'Veon Bell ain't playing for the Steelers this year ... and maybe never again -- 'cause the All-Pro RB just missed the deadline to report to the team.
Bell -- who's been holding out since the offseason in search of a new mega-deal with Pittsburgh -- had until 1 PM PT to sign his franchise tag.
But ... the deadline came and went with no Bell to be found.
As we previously reported ... Bell's been tearin' it up on jet skis and in nightclubs during his time away from the squad -- but most, including the team's owner, expected him to be back with the team today.
Bell, though, decided against it ... and will now forfeit ALL of the $14.5 MILLION the Steelers were set to pay him this season.
It's not like Pitt's exactly crying over the move ... James Conner's been killin' it in Bell's stead -- and teammates have ripped the RB for his holdout throughout the past few months.
In fact, even coach Mike Tomlin threw some shade Bell's way Tuesday ... saying if this so happens to be the last time he ever coaches Bell, "So be it."

Cam Newton Honoring Pitt. Synagogue Victims 'Stronger than Hate' Cleats
Cam Newton's going against the Pittsburgh Steelers on the field ... but he's standing united with the city Thursday night ... honoring the synagogue shooting victims with "Stronger than Hate" cleats.
The Panthers superstar revealed the kicks just minutes ago during pregame warm-ups ... showing a mock-up of the Steelers logo with a Star of David and the phrase "Hatred Can't Weaken a City of Steel."
Ben Roethlisberger wore similar custom cleats over the weekend against the Ravens ... and Julian Edelman showed support with a Team Israel hat from the World Baseball Classic after the Patriots game on Sunday.
As we previously reported ... an active shooter opened fire at a Jewish synagogue in Pittsburgh during a prayer service on October 27, leaving 11 people dead in the anti-Semitic attack.
The Penguins honored the victims as well last month ... with a special patch on their uniforms and donated $50,000 to help victims and their families.
